Hi, My brother has a 91 chevy dually 3500, 1 ton and gets 7 mpg (454 motor). He is wondering what he can do to increase his mpg. Would he have to just get a new motor? He likes the truck but it's killing him on mpg's. Thanks!

Re: Better mpg for 91 dually
i had a 86' with a 454, but it was carberated.. i got 8-10 mpg on good days. i did noticed a little bit of mileage increase with a 3" exhaust system with dual flowmaster mufflers, and a K&N filter. In your case, a K&N air intake system can be put on. So maybe u might see an increase, try also using a throttle body spacer...that might help as well... hope this helped...
